Talbot family statement on the passing of the Hon. Gerald E. Talbot
PORTLAND, ME — The Talbot family released the following statement after the passing of Gerald E. Talbot on Saturday, May 9.
The Talbot family is deeply saddened by the passing of Gerald E. Talbot, a beloved brother, husband, father, grandfather, great-grandfather and uncle.
A pioneering human rights leader in Maine and throughout New England, Gerald devoted his life to advancing civil rights, social and economic justice and strengthening the voices of marginalized communities. He made history as Maine’s first African American elected to the Maine State Legislature, which paved the way for generations of leaders from all backgrounds to pursue public service.
He will be remembered not only for his groundbreaking leadership but for his kindness, wisdom, humility, sense of humor and generosity of spirit.
